Full Name
Katanin Catalytic Subunit A1 Like 1
Function
Regulates microtubule dynamics in Sertoli cells, a process that is essential for spermiogenesis and male fertility. Severs microtubules in an ATP-dependent manner, promoting rapid reorganization of cellular microtubule arrays (By similarity).
Has microtubule-severing activity in vitro (PubMed:26929214).

Cellular Location
Cytoplasm, cytoskeleton; Cytoplasm; Cytoplasm, cytoskeleton, spindle pole; Cytoplasm, cytoskeleton, spindle. Colocalizes with microtubules throughout the basal and adluminal compartments of Sertoli cells (By similarity).
Localizes within the cytoplasm, partially overlapping with microtubules, in interphase and to the mitotic spindle and spindle poles during mitosis (PubMed:26929214).
